This vintage drinks cabinet by Jaycee showcases the brand’s signature Gothic Revival influence, with richly carved details and robust iron-style fittings. The upper section features a mirrored drop-down compartment with glass shelving—ideal for mixing and serving drinks—while the lower double-door cupboard provides ample storage for bottles and barware. A central drawer adds additional utility, and all components are finished with finely tooled ring pulls and decorative hardware. The carved diamond motifs and vertical fluting give the piece a distinguished, traditional character. The previous darker stain has been stripped, and then multiple coats of hard-wearing matte lacquer have been applied, providing a durable long-lasting finish while also accentuating the natural oak grain. This cabinet is made mostly from oak, with oak-veneered panels. The back of the cabinet and the base of the drawer are constructed from plywood.
